Kevin Owens WWE reaction drew attention after Carmelo Hayes achieved a major milestone by winning his first championship on the WWE main roster. On December 26, 2025, during WWE SmackDown, Hayes defeated Ilja Dragunov to seize the United States Championship in a match taped the previous week, marking a pivotal point in Hayes’ career and generating an outpouring of support from fellow wrestlers and fans.
Carmelo Hayes Makes History on SmackDown
Carmelo Hayes secured his historic victory over Ilja Dragunov to claim the United States Championship, signaling his arrival as a force on the main roster. The match, which aired on December 26, 2025, showcased Hayes’ determination, culminating in a win that brought both personal and professional fulfillment. Immediately after the televised broadcast, Hayes responded to WWE’s coverage of the event with a heartfelt message, reflecting on the significance of the accomplishment for himself and his supporters.
I felt the people lift me to top rope, can’t even explain it.
— Carmelo Hayes, WWE Superstar

Carmelo Hayes’ Rising Profile in WWE
By capturing the United States Championship, Carmelo Hayes added to a growing résumé that already included the 2025 Andre the Giant Memorial Battle Royal and several dominant runs in NXT. Among his prior accomplishments, Hayes has held the NXT World Championship, the NXT Cruiserweight Championship, and won the NXT North American Championship on two separate occasions.
The United States Championship serves as a defining achievement for Hayes on WWE’s main stage, setting the stage for future opportunities and rivalries that could further elevate his profile within the company.
Kevin Owens’ Own Battle and Continued WWE Involvement
While Hayes’ victory took center stage, Kevin Owens’ career has recently been marked by a hiatus as he recovers from neck surgery performed in July. Owens addressed his uncertain future during a public appearance at a NASCAR event in August, where updates on his recovery and hopes for a return were candidly shared with fans and the wrestling community.
Fingers crossed, I get to come back to wrestling in the next year,
— Kevin Owens, Former Universal Champion
I really don’t know. My goal is to come back, so hopefully that happens.
— Kevin Owens, Former Universal Champion
Despite his recovery process and time away from in-ring action, Owens is expected to stay active within WWE, with reports indicating he will participate in the upcoming season of WWE LFG on A&E, maintaining his connection to the brand and its storytelling beyond the ring.
